Poco F5 was being suggested when it was selling close to 30k. At 21k, it should be an easy choice.
 
+1 to Poco F5 at 21k

If you are willing to sacrifice a bit on battery life, Pixel 6a is another contender.

If you can extend budget a bit, Nothing Phone 1 is a more balanced option at 23-24k.

I have poco X5 pro 5g and poco f5.
Both are very good in camera and performance respectively.

But when the battery endurance considered
The poco X5 pro had a little better battery, after watching almost all reviews on YouTube.
After I made a purchase, I found out different results.
Poco f5 gives better battery life on the "5g++" with hotspot connected TV.
~1% battery drain in 1 hour.
From 37% to 36%.

778G is good but don't consider old chipsets now.
Other experts can shed more light on this.

This is what I experienced.

Also not used 67watt charger came with both phones.
Still using 10 watt, 18 watt and sometimes 27 watt charger.
Mostly 10 watt charger.
Charging is slow but battery will lost long.
Slow charging is best for device.
